Acute Hepatitis C Infection
Once someone is infected with hepatitis C, the first phase of the disease is called acute infection.
It lasts from two to 12 weeks.
The most common symptom of acute infection is no symptoms.
Sometimes people with acute infection feel as if they have the flu.
